My research focuses on the intersection of inflammatory bowel disease (IBD) and chronic kidney disease (CKD), two conditions with significant long-term health consequences. Using large-scale epidemiological data, I have investigated the bidirectional association between IBD and CKD, revealing an increased risk of kidney dysfunction in patients with IBD. I have also examined how colectomy in IBD patients influences kidney failure risk and assessed whether biologic treatments for IBD elevate the likelihood of kidney disease.
